Output 12af73ee4efed3d95ff185dd620615245d1cbfc2df1e48b11bd88f301c24ce94:3

value
76820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82bb7e75906758dcb07c100d09ed9c4784dfec94 OP_EQUAL
address
3DcGNntGaZgqFQUX34g7Br1YoisSYURc5S
transaction
12af73ee4efed3d95ff185dd620615245d1cbfc2df1e48b11bd88f301c24ce94
spent
true